The origins of the fruit machine go back to the late 19th century when the very first mechanical fruit machine, the Liberty Bell, was developed by Charles Fey in 1895. This machine included 3 spinning reels with signs such as horseshoes, diamonds, spades, hearts, and a broken Liberty Bell, which provided the machine its name. The simplicity of pulling a lever and enjoying the reels spin was an immediate hit, and the style quickly spread to bars and saloons. Players were drawn to the excitement of chance, and the potential for small payouts kept them coming back.

As technology advanced, so did slot machines. The intro of electrical parts in the mid-20th century permitted more complicated game designs and larger prizes. By the 1960s, electromechanical slots ended up being the standard, featuring flashing lights and electronic sounds that added to the overall experience. The lever, once a staple of slot machines, started to be changed by buttons, making the machines simpler to operate. These advancements not only increased the appeal of slots but also their success for casinos.

The genuine transformation in slots technology came with the advent of video slots in the 1970s. These machines used computer technology to create digital reels and more detailed game styles. Video slots enabled a greater variety of themes, bonus games, and interactive features. This evolution changed slot machines from basic gambling devices into engaging home entertainment experiences. Themes ranging from ancient civilizations to popular motion pictures and tv shows broadened the appeal of slots, bring in a larger audience.

The introduction of online casinos in the mid-1990s marked another significant milestone for slot machines. Digital technology made it possible for designers to create online slots that could be played from anywhere with a web connection. Online slots kept the fundamental concepts of their mechanical and video predecessors however added new layers of benefit and availability. Players no longer had to visit a physical casino to enjoy their preferred games; they might now play from the comfort of their own homes or on the go with mobile phones.

Online slots have actually continued to evolve, incorporating innovative technology to improve the player experience. Random number generators (RNGs) ensure fair play, while high-definition graphics, immersive soundtracks, and intricate animations create visually stunning games. Lots of online slots now feature progressive jackpots, where a part of each bet contributes to a growing reward swimming pool that can reach life-changing amounts. These jackpots are often connected throughout multiple games and platforms, further increasing the potential for enormous payouts.

The appeal of casino slots lies in their simplicity and the adventure of chance. Unlike table games such as poker or blackjack, which need strategy and ability, slots are purely games of luck. This makes them available to all players, despite experience or understanding. The rules are straightforward: insert money, select your bet, and spin the reels. Winning mixes of symbols result in payouts, with bigger rewards often tied to rarer symbol combinations or special bonus features.

Bonus features are a key element of modern slot games, including excitement and range to gameplay. These features can include totally free spins, multipliers, wild symbols, and interactive bonus rounds that often include skill-based mini-games or story-driven elements. Bonus rounds not just increase the potential for profits but also enhance the home entertainment value of the game, keeping players engaged for longer durations.

The design and psychology behind slot machines play a significant function in their popularity. Developers utilize a combination of brilliant colors, engaging noises, and satisfying feedback systems to create a compelling and satisfying experience. The idea of near-misses, where the reels stop just except a winning combination, can motivate players to continue playing, fueled by the belief that a big win is just around the corner. The randomness of results and the intermittent nature of benefits create a powerful mental reinforcement loop that can be extremely engaging.
